Wikipedia:SHEIC/Archief/2021-04


wikidata sjabloon bewerken

Wie weet hoe {{wikidata}} wiki code genereert? Bijvoorbeeld op Avidemux is er nu een foutmelding in de references, die onstaat door {{wikidata|property|qualifier|qualifiers|references|normal+|edit|P348|P577|P400|P548=Q2804309}}. Dit is hopelijk op te lossen zonder een aanpassing op wikidata zelf. ∼ Wimmel (overleg) 4 apr 2021 23:35 (CEST)[reageer]

Er valt wat voor te zeggen dat Sjabloon:Citeer web te streng is. –bdijkstra (overleg) 4 apr 2021 23:57 (CEST)[reageer]

5 apr 2021 21:39 (CEST)

Hi Techies,

het Sjabloon dat datum en uur voor equinox en zonnewende per jaar weergeeft was verouderd geraakt (Sjabloon:Zijbalk zonnewende dus, liep maar tot 2020). Ik heb het net aangepast door de komende jaren te kopiëren van de Engelstalige template. Nu zag ik dat ze daar een Template hebben die jaar na jaar automatisch een jaar opschuift. Zou ook handig zijn voor ons, maar ik krijg het zelf technisch niet vertaald. Als iemand zin heeft: Template:Solstice-equinox op de Engelstalige wikipdia.

Mushlack (overleg) 6 apr 2021 20:12 (CEST)[reageer]

19 apr 2021 18:48 (CEST)

About deploying StructuredCategories in the Dutch Wikipedia bewerken

Hello,

I developed a Gadget that generates a link to a structured description of a given Wikimedia category based on the commonly used Wikidata statements to efficiently define its direct members. Please find the description of the Gadget at https://www.wikidata.org/wiki/Wikidata:Structured_Categories and its JavaScript source code at https://www.wikidata.org/wiki/User:Csisc/StructuredCategories.js. I ask how to deploy this tool in the Dutch Wikipedia so that it can be featured in the Preferences for users.

Yours Sincerely,

--Csisc (overleg) 16 apr 2021 16:27 (CEST)[reageer]

Is there a wiki (preferably using Latin script) where we can already see this gadget in action? –bdijkstra (overleg) 16 apr 2021 18:14 (CEST)[reageer]
bdijkstra: Italian Wikipedia has accepted to test the tool. You can tick StructuredCategories in Preferences and see the output of the tool. Csisc (overleg) 17 apr 2021 17:08 (CEST)[reageer]
I have some questions about the output of the tool. Do you have a page on Wikidata for feedback and questions? –bdijkstra (overleg) 17 apr 2021 18:46 (CEST)[reageer]
bdijkstra: Of course, feel free to ask any question at my talk page in Wikidata or at d:Wikidata talk:Structured Categories. Csisc (overleg) 17 apr 2021 21:20 (CEST)[reageer]
An update: The code is currently available at meta:MediaWiki:Gadget-StructuredCategories.js. Csisc (overleg) 20 apr 2021 15:07 (CEST)[reageer]

26 apr 2021 23:24 (CEST)

Sortable tabel, en wens voor een schuifbalkje bewerken

Hi,

Ik ben bezig met Sjabloon:Zijbalk tabel uitbraak SARS-CoV-2, waar nu tweemaal daags een botje voorbijkomt voor een update van de coronacijfers. Echter, hoewel in wikidata de cijfers met punt worden ingevoerd (voor zover ik kan zien?) worden sommige miljoenen op nl-wp weergegeven met een komma in plaats van een punt. Gebruik je vervolgens de sorteeroptie in de header van de tabel, dan komt bv India onterecht onderaan te staan met meer dan 17 miljoen doden. Is er een code om dit op te lossen? De boteigenaar herkent dit probleem niet, en ik zie de fout inderdaad niet op andere talen die van de bot gebruik maken.

Daarnaast is de hele tabel nu ingeklapt, en ik zie op andere talen als alternatief hiervoor ook wel een schuifbalk aan de zijkant van de tabel. Dit sjabloon zorgt voor een schuifbalkje, waarmee je dit resultaat krijgt en lijkt me ook breder handig bij lange tabellen als deze. Het sjabloon gebruikt wel een lua-module, maar misschien is hier iemand die zich eraan wil wagen? Ciell need me? ping me! 27 apr 2021 22:55 (CEST)[reageer]

Het probleem met India is hier ontstaan. Om de een of andere reden worden deze cijfers uit Wikidata gehaald, wat op zich goed gaat: {{wdib|ps=1|P1603|qid=Q84055514|list=p-1}} levert 33.766.707. Maar als je daar formatnum op toe gaat passen, krijg je komma's: 33,766,707. –bdijkstra (overleg) 28 apr 2021 00:07 (CEST)[reageer]
Hetzelfde geldt voor Indonesie. HenkvD (overleg) 28 apr 2021 16:11 (CEST)[reageer]
Dank voor het meekijken beide: ik heb ze doorgegeven aan de boteigenaar. Hij herkende wat jullie zeiden en heeft het volgens hem opgelost. Dank! Dadelijk om 18 uur zal de bot het registreren als fout, en als het goed is bij de run van morgenochtend om 6 uur opnieuw verwerken. Ciell need me? ping me! 28 apr 2021 17:53 (CEST)[reageer]

Mediawiki timestamp bewerken

De Mediawiki API geeft bij een bewerking een timestamp mee, bijvoorbeeld "2021-04-30T07:22:18Z". Ik zou graag (voor een gebruikersscript) het aantal minuten sinds zo'n timestamp achterhalen. Maar hoe kan dat? Javascript geeft bijv. voor Date.now(); 1619769105803. Hoe converteer ik de Mediawiki timestamp naar een getal vergelijkbaar met Date.now(), zodat ik de tijd daartussen kan berekenen? N👁vopas (overleg) 30 apr 2021 09:56 (CEST)[reageer]

Date.parse("2021-04-30T07:22:18Z") --Frank Geerlings (overleg) 30 apr 2021 13:13 (CEST)

Wow, zo eenvoudig  . Bedankt! N👁vopas (overleg) 30 apr 2021 13:25 (CEST)[reageer]